Transaction 88b631003dab8464a9acb35515dc8c2072c844c185e6d00bd71cb696fe272c07
1 Input
2 Outputs
- 88b631003dab8464a9acb35515dc8c2072c844c185e6d00bd71cb696fe272c07:0
- 88b631003dab8464a9acb35515dc8c2072c844c185e6d00bd71cb696fe272c07:1
value 4447610816
address 1G7dcRpsgEkfMqud1HynTorNMan3ccbcRu
value 313304
address 15w91Je9wPdnwGj7kH2YjPWX5723NBjDTx